  9. So last year Allen was a top five QB in both passer rating and first down percentage on 3rd and 10+ plays. The one concerning area is that Allen had 44 such attempts on 3rd and 10+, good for the 9th most 3rd and long attempts in the league. Fast forward to 2020 and Allen is still a leader in first down percentage. He is tied with a couple players at 40% (improved from 32% last year). I believe only Derek Carr had a higher first down percentage on 3rd and 10+ than Allen this year. Carr was 41.6%. For passer rating, Allen's 106.6 rating was good enough for 5th highest among all starting QB's. And the attempts plummeted from 44 in 2019 down to only 27 in 2020 which was low enough to rank him tied with Lamar Jackson for second fewest attempts behind Carr's league low 24. So in 2020 we saw the best of both worlds. The Bills and Allen were forced into a league low number of 3rd and 10+ plays. At the same time Allen remained a league leader in first down percentage and passer rating, ranking second and fifth in the league respectively. Some notable players in comparison: Josh Allen: 40.7% 1st down % 106.6 passer rating 27 Attempts Aaron Rodgers: 33.3% 1st down % 89.1 passer rating 36 Attempts Patrick Mahomes: 25.6% 1st down % 86.4 passer rating 39 Attempts (Mahomes lead the league last year with a 122.8 rating) Phillip Rivers: 12.5% 1st down % 74.5 passer rating 40 Attempts Stathead: 3rd and 10+ passing statistics

Mahomes vs. Allen growth throughout their career* Mahomes: 2018 Games 2-9 115.3 rating 2018 Games 10-17 112.4 rating 2019 Games 18-24 113.1 rating 2019 Games 25-31 97.6 rating 2020 Games 32-39 115.0 rating 2020 Games 40-46 101.9 rating Allen: 2018 Games 1-6 61.8 rating 2018 Games 7-12 72.6 rating 2019 Games 13-20 82.9 rating 2019 Games 21-27 88.8 rating 2020 Games 29-36 102.4 rating 2020 Games 40-46 111.6 rating 2021 ??? *excluded Mahomes first career game since it was only one start at the end of the 2017 season *excluded the final game of the season for Allen in 2019 because he only played one series Cowherd touched on this topic this morning on his show. Mahomes has consistently been great from the start. He sat and learned behind a good veteran QB his first year. His first year starting Mahomes was throwing to Kelce and Tyreek Hill and had a proven offensive genius designing and calling plays. Hill and Kelce were already proven all-pro caliber players before Mahomes became the starter. Allen was forced into starting and did not have a proven veteran QB to learn behind. His mentor was Nathan Peterman for the first half of the season for crying out loud. Allen was throwing to receivers who are either not currently in the NFL or not starting for any teams since the 2018 season. Allen has a good coaching staff around him now but Allen and the staff had to build their offensive identity over the last three years. Allen hasn't yet had the same peaks in passer rating that Mahomes has achieved several times through his career already but if we look at Allen's trend, it's not hard to imagine that at some point next year, either the first half of the season, second half of the season or even both, Allen will probably top his career high 111.6 passer rating.

  15. Odd change this year to the roster. Last year the AP all pro team had a flex position on both the 1st and 2nd teams. And only two WR spots on both the 1st and 2nd teams. The 2020 team they got rid of the flex spot and named three WR's for both the 1st and 2nd team (five for the 2nd team because three receivers tied with 1 vote each for the third spot on the second team). And the 2019 team the Flex player named for both the first and second team was also the RB named for that same team (McCaffery and Henry). Glad they changed it this year as having the same player seems kind of dumb.
